Searching for an "Apple Music IPA cracked" often leads to a rabbit hole of technical workarounds and security warnings. While many users seek ways to bypass subscription costs, the reality of cracking a server-side service like Apple Music is vastly different from modding a local offline game. If your budget does not allow for a paid subscription, platforms like Spotify, YouTube Music, and Amazon Music offer official, ad-supported free tiers. These services grant legal access to millions of songs, playlists, and podcasts without compromising your device's security. Searching for an "Apple Music IPA cracked" often
